21xrx.com
2025-03-20 05:47:33 Thursday
文章检索 我的文章 写文章
我最近学习了Java中set的用法
2023-06-11 23:50:26 深夜i     12     0
Java set 数据结构

我最近学习了Java中set的用法,发现它可以帮助我们更好地管理数据。set是Collection框架中的一种数据结构,使用它可以实现快速查找、删除和添加元素。

首先,我们需要创建一个set对象,常见的set对象有HashSet、LinkedHashSet和TreeSet。例如,创建一个HashSet对象可以使用以下代码:

Set
  mySet = new HashSet 
  
   ();

接下来,我们可以使用add()方法向set中添加元素:

mySet.add("apple");
mySet.add("banana");
mySet.add("orange");

如果我们想删除set中的某个元素,可以使用remove()方法:

mySet.remove("banana");

同时,我们也可以使用contains()方法来判断set中是否包含某个元素:

if(mySet.contains("apple"))
  // do something

另外,set还提供了一些其他有用的方法,如size()方法获取set中元素的数量,isEmpty()方法判断set是否为空等等。

最后,需要注意的是,当我们从set中获取元素时,获取的元素顺序是不确定的。如果我们需要按照特定的顺序进行排序,可以考虑使用TreeSet。

综上所述,使用set可以帮助我们更方便、快捷地对数据进行管理,具有非常实用的功能。如果你也在学习Java,不妨去尝试一下set的用法吧!

  
  

评论区